The Bell Boy
Trailer: The Bell Boy
Year: 1918
Genre: Comedy
Studio: Comique Film Company
Director: Roscoe 'Fatty' Arbuckle
Cast: Roscoe 'Fatty' Arbuckle, Buster Keaton, Al St. John, Alice Lake, Joe Keaton, Charles Dudley
Crew: Roscoe 'Fatty' Arbuckle (Director), Roscoe 'Fatty' Arbuckle (Screenplay), Roscoe 'Fatty' Arbuckle (Story), Herbert Warren (Editor), Joseph M. Schenck (Producer), George Peters (Director of Photography)
Runtime: 26 minutes
Release: Mar 18, 1918
